It worked pretty well for what we needed to do, however we did things different then you are talking about First, you are talking about splitting your BCV mirror every 30 minutes. You might want to look into that more because if I remember correctly, our synchronize was taking over 2 hours. However, we needed to attach broken mirrors every time. You might be able to make that time by only needing to sync your changes (depending on how much you have going on in the database). Second, we always placed the database in backup mode whenever we split the BCV. We used the archive logs to recover the dbfiles that were copied in the split, just as if recovering from a hot backup. We sent continuos copies of our archive logs over to the DR site along with the BCV split site to do a recovery if it was needed. We never went for the "one single atomic action", mainly because we just never felt 100% comfortable with it. Add in the fact that there really is no rolling forward if you are not placing the database in backup mode. If you are only taking a snapshot every x minutes, x minutes of data loss is guaranteed. As far as being certified by Oracle, our on site support said no at the time. It is pretty much the same as taking a backup of a database after a shutdown abort. It might work fine, just wasn't supported/recommended by Oracle. The way it works is that when you create a >>snapshot >>it creates a file which contains a pointer to the database file. When >>someone >>changes the database, the before image is written to the snapshot file. At >>this >>point the file is no longer just a pointer it containts before image data. >>The >>backup, will backup the snapshot, not the database file. This provides a >>consistent image. This is very different than EMC Timefinder, which is used >>to >>backup a mirrored database. When you break the mirror Timefinder ensures >>that >>no data is in the buffers that would make the mirrored data incomplete. At >>this >>point you can bring the mirrored database down and get a cold backup, then >>resync the mirrors.
